Output 0017295f745046de368db901b029ae407a6031c35a4ef35f8e0e6c3c5155cd60:3

value
140440892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e139fe323c9b221809c17089899e609b297a2b4 OP_EQUAL
address
3QrT4okxfJAmYFCt4gsmkBaUm7TjYxmHWt
transaction
0017295f745046de368db901b029ae407a6031c35a4ef35f8e0e6c3c5155cd60
spent
true